1. Harnessing AI-Driven Analytics: How Machine Learning Enhances Strategic Planning

In the rapidly evolving landscape of strategic planning, AI-driven analytics are emerging as a transformative force, enabling organizations to refine their decision-making processes. According to a report by McKinsey & Company, companies that adopt advanced analytical techniques can expect a 5-6% increase in productivity compared to their peers . Machine learning algorithms sift through vast datasets to uncover patterns and insights that human analysts might overlook. For instance, a leading retail company used AI to analyze customer behavior and optimize its inventory management, resulting in a 20% reduction in stockouts and a 15% increase in sales . This demonstrates how leveraging AI not only supports strategic planning but also drives tangible business outcomes.

As firms navigate the complexities of long-term strategy formulation, the use of machine learning in analytics empowers them to simulate various scenarios and track key performance indicators with unparalleled accuracy. A recent study from Gartner indicates that organizations utilizing AI-driven analytics for strategic planning are 2.5 times more likely to see significant improvements in strategic outcomes compared to those that rely solely on traditional methods . Look no further than the success of a major automotive company that integrated AI into its operational strategy, allowing it to forecast market trends and adjust its product roadmap effectively. The result? A 30% faster response time to market changes, showcasing the undeniable impact of AI on modern strategic planning endeavors.

2. The Rise of Decision Intelligence: Transforming Data into Actionable Insights

Decision intelligence is rapidly emerging as a transformative technology that empowers organizations to turn data into actionable insights. By combining artificial intelligence, machine learning, and data analysis, decision intelligence platforms enable companies to make more informed strategic decisions. A notable example is how Unilever leveraged decision intelligence to optimize their supply chain operations. By using predictive analytics and real-time data, Unilever improved demand forecasting accuracy, allowing them to respond effectively to changing consumer behavior. This not only minimized waste but also streamlined inventory management, showcasing how decision intelligence can enhance long-term strategic planning efforts. 3. Incorporating Blockchain for Transparency and Security in Strategic Planning

In today's rapidly evolving digital landscape, incorporating blockchain technology into strategic planning offers unprecedented levels of transparency and security. According to a report by PwC, 77% of executives believe that blockchain will be critical to their organization by 2024 (PwC, 2021). This decentralized ledger technology enhances trustworthiness, as it stores data across a network of computers, making it nearly impossible to alter or delete information without consensus. For instance, IBM has demonstrated the power of blockchain in supply chain management, where stakeholders access real-time data on product provenance. By integrating blockchain, organizations can ensure transparency in their strategic planning efforts, navigate complex regulatory environments, and foster collaboration among diverse teams, ultimately leading to more robust decision-making.

Moreover, the use of blockchain in strategic planning is not just hypothetical; it is already demonstrating value in real-world applications. A case study conducted by the Harvard Business Review highlighted how De Beers adopted blockchain to trace diamonds from mines to retailers, ensuring ethical sourcing and reducing fraud (HBR, 2021). This initiative not only enhanced transparency but also increased consumer trust, leading to a reported 15% rise in customer retention. As organizations embrace blockchain, they can leverage real-time insights while safeguarding sensitive data, transforming strategic planning into a more accountable and efficient process. The potential benefits of adopting blockchain in this context are substantial, and as more companies explore its applications, the way strategic planning unfolds will continue to evolve.


4. How IoT Data Integration is Shaping Real-Time Strategic Decision Making

IoT data integration is increasingly influencing real-time strategic decision-making by enabling organizations to leverage vast amounts of data generated by connected devices. For instance, companies like GE have implemented IoT in their manufacturing processes, using real-time data to optimize operations, predict equipment failures, and enhance productivity. A case study published by IBM highlights how the IoT data enabled Caterpillar to improve its fleet management, resulting in a 15% reduction in operational costs through real-time insights. This integration facilitates a more agile response to market dynamics, allowing businesses to pivot strategies quickly based on live data trends .

Furthermore, real-time decision-making powered by IoT data promotes proactive rather than reactive strategies. In 2024, organizations are encouraged to adopt platforms like Microsoft Azure IoT or AWS IoT for seamless data integration, which can harness analytics for deeper insights. According to a report by McKinsey, businesses that utilize IoT data in strategic planning can achieve up to 20% improvements in operational efficiency. By embedding IoT analytics into their workflows, firms can create predictive models that simulate various scenarios, much like a flight simulator allows pilots to practice in different conditions before taking actual flights .

5. Exploring the Benefits of Predictive Analytics: Real-World Success Stories

In the dynamic realm of strategic planning, predictive analytics has emerged as a game-changer, driving businesses to make data-driven decisions with remarkable agility. A striking example is Walmart, which employs predictive analytics to forecast customer demand, resulting in a 10% reduction in promotional costs and a 5% increase in sales during promotional periods. By analyzing historical sales data and seasonal trends, Walmart manages inventory effectively, ensuring that their shelves are stocked with the right products at precisely the right time . Furthermore, a study by McKinsey revealed that companies using predictive analytics in their strategic planning report up to a 20% increase in profitability compared to their peers, showcasing the undeniable advantages of data foresight in today’s competitive landscape .

Notably, the healthcare sector illustrates the transformative impact of predictive analytics on strategic planning. For instance, Mount Sinai Health System harnessed predictive models to reduce readmission rates by 30%, ultimately saving millions in healthcare costs. By analyzing a vast array of patient data, including previous admission rates and social determinants, they devised targeted interventions that significantly improved patient outcomes . Moreover, a survey from the Healthcare Information and Management Systems Society (HIMSS) showed that 58% of healthcare organizations that utilized predictive analytics reported more accurate strategic planning, indicating that this technology not only drives operational efficiency but also enhances the quality of care delivered to patients .

7. Augmented Reality: Visualizing Long-Term Strategies with Innovation

As the digital landscape evolves, augmented reality (AR) is paving the way for innovative approaches in long-term strategic planning. A recent study by Deloitte reveals that 88% of executives believe that AR will be critical in enhancing customer engagement and decision-making processes. For instance, the multinational giant IKEA has successfully integrated AR in its planning tools, allowing users to visualize their future living spaces effectively. Their app, IKEA Place, offers a staggering 98% accuracy in placing virtual furniture in real-world environments, demonstrating how AR aids not only in consumer experience but also in strategic foresight. By providing immersive visuals, businesses can analyze scenarios tailored to their unique needs, resulting in strategies that are more aligned with market demands.

Moreover, the use of augmented reality in scenario planning is on the rise, with studies indicating that companies leveraging AR in their strategic frameworks report a 30% increase in project success rates. A notable case study from the construction sector, published by McKinsey, highlights the impact of AR on project planning through real-time data visualization and collaboration among team members. By overlays of project timelines and resource allocations, AR empowers stakeholders to make informed decisions faster, reducing miscommunications and enhancing productivity. With AR expected to reach a market value of $198 billion by 2025, its implementation in strategic planning software presents an unprecedented opportunity for organizations to visualize their ambitions with clarity and precision.
